First batch of Saudi relief aid for those affected by floods in Sudan to arrive tomorrow


(MENAFN- Saudi Press Agency)
Khartoum, Dhu-AlQa'dah 21, 1437, August 24, 2016, SPA -- Saudi Ambassador to Sudan Faisal bin Hamid Mualla said that the first batch of the kingdom's relief aid, that were directed by the Custodian of the Two Holy Mosques King Salman bin Abdulaziz Al Saud to help those affected by the floods and rains in Sudan, will arrive to Khartoum on Thursday.
This came in a speech delivered by the Saudi ambassador at a ceremony held here today on the occasion of the opening of the Saudi Health Center in Al-Brakah suburb south of the Sudanese capital Khartoum.
